My dvd rips tend to become blurry when theres a lot of movement on the clip. Anyone can advise me on how to fix this? I use CladDvd to rip the vobfiles, then i use virtualdub to encode with divx 5.02. I have seen good dvd rips like Love Hina Kanako ova. I use the deinterlace and subtitle filters on virtualdub, and the codec configurations are 3000 bitrate on 1-pass. Thanx by the way.

Which deinterlace filter are you using? If it's the internal one you're throwing away half your vertical resolution. With an adaptive deinterlacer you can retain a lot of that information.

Of course, if your material actually needs IVTC instead of deinterlacing, then that is really going to yuck up the result if you deinterlace it.

In case you can IVTC to get progressive frames, you might like to try MSharpen. It can be done on interlaced material as well, but to make it work best you have to first separate fields, then sharpen, then weave.
